One – Your body needs Omega 3
Omega 3 fatty acids like DHA and EPA are considered “Essential” fatty acids. These fats are essential for your body functions to perform well. This includes your heart, blood circulation, your brain, the retina in your eyes, your joints and each and every body cell that can fall prey to inflammation.
While it has been proven beyond doubt that DHA and EPA are highly beneficial for the human body, the tragedy is that the average person’s diet is severely lacking in this group of nutrients. Not to forget that your body cannot produce these fats internally, they have to be taken through an external source. This is where quality omega 3 supplements can help by filling the gap in your diet and giving your body all the omega 3 it needs.
